To be honest, using the official app made it feel like 75 Medium. The biggest thing is keeping track of everything and making time for it no matter what.
Learn the rules, ignore the subreddit. There’s too much bickering over what counts and what doesn’t. This isn’t for anyone but you. Read the rules/review the FAQ on the website (the app links to it) and do it every day for 75 days if you see value in doing it. You don’t get a medal out of it, and it really isn’t nor shouldn’t be about bragging and seeking approval. I think having close friends who get it and can support you is valuable. Otherwise, ignore what anyone says, even here. You know in your heart what you are meant to do. You don’t need affirmation, praise, or coddling.
I recommend The Courage to Be Disliked and The Courage to Be Happy for your reading. I read the former before I started, and the latter was my last book. They will help reiterate the points I made above. Know that you have the ability to be self-reliant, re-define your past from your present, and move forward knowing your life tasks. People are your comrades. This isn’t a competition.
I actually don’t think 75 Hard is for everyone. It’s certainly not meant for your physical health. My sleep is pretty messed up for working out a net 90 minutes everyday for 75 days straight. Halfway through I started questioning its validity, but I kept doing it because I said I would do it. I needed to make working out and monitoring my sugar intake an ingrained habit, and the gamification of “all or nothing” thinking got that done for me. Now I can live a more balanced life. But truthfully, there are much healthier ways to build “mental fortitude.”
I’m about to go for a short walk and get some blue light before I head to work today. It’s nice. :)
My final takeaway is 75 day commitments make for a good template. Rather than moving on to Phase 1, I may just make new 75 day to-do lists (e.g. meditate daily, study a language for 45 min twice a day, sleep 8+ hours, etc etc).
Do not procrastinate on anything. Get up, drink 24-32 oz of water, get moving. Get enough sleep.
